Overview
LISC 1757 is a moderately populated, very dense object of very high C3 quality. Its parallax locates it at a moderate* distance, near the mid-plane, affected by moderate extinction. It is catalogued as a very metal-poor, intermediate-age cluster (see Parameters). It is rarely studied in the literature.
â ī¸ Warning: This is likely a duplicate object, which shares a large percentage of members with at least one previously reported entry. See table with shared members information.
(*): The parallax distance estimate (~2.44 kpc) differs significantly from the median photometric distance (~1.66 kpc).
